So I'm gon na go over some facts about our pieces, so they're synthetic they're, not human, hair, they're unable to be curled, so the style that they are is how they're gon na stay, but that doesn't makes them nice. When you go to an event and it's humid or it's hot or it's raining, the piece will dry and stay exactly the same way. It makes it really nice, so you don't have to use gobs of hairspray and you don't have to worry about the curls falling out, but this is a scrunchie and shade aside here and I will show you what it looks like. So in the morning I put my hair into a messy bun. I don't do anything. Fancy I like a lot of texture um, so I just throw it on up into a little messy bun kind of fluff it out, and I pull out some hair to give me some volume in the front. Like I said, I love big hair. You don't have to do this; this is just what I do. I just wanted to give you guys like a little example of how easy it is. I have short layers. We have to pin up the back okay. Next, we have the stick when you come in, we will show you how to do all this, but this goes underneath of your elastic and it'll be completely concealed by the time that we're finished. So then this goes underneath of that. Pin that we put in our hair and that's what's gon na give you the security. I'Ve never had a hairpiece fall out on me when I'm wearing my pin. So I am never honestly concerned and I wear these to work out in I let him on my runs. I want him to CrossFit and I wear them at the hospital, so I mean I'm always I'm just the person, that's always on the go and then I just fluff it up to get all that volume and good texture going on.
